What is an AutoCAD Project Manager?

An AutoCAD Project Manager is a professional who oversees design projects that utilize AutoCAD software, ensuring that drafting and design tasks are completed accurately and on schedule. They coordinate between clients, engineers, architects, and drafting teams to manage project timelines, resources, and deliverables. Their role includes supervising drawing production, maintaining quality standards, and resolving any technical issues related to AutoCAD. They also often handle project budgeting and communication to ensure the successful completion of design objectives.

How does an AutoCAD Project Manager typically coordinate with design and engineering teams during a project?

An AutoCAD Project Manager regularly collaborates with design and engineering teams to ensure project drawings and technical documentation meet both client requirements and industry standards. This involves leading coordination meetings, reviewing and providing feedback on CAD models, and managing revisions based on input from architects, engineers, and stakeholders. The manager also ensures that deadlines are met and that any issues with design compatibility or constructability are resolved promptly. Effective communication and organization are key, as the Project Manager often acts as the central point of contact for all drawing-related queries throughout the project lifecycle.

AutoCAD Drafter / CAD Technician | Tulsa, OK


About the Role

We are seeking a detail-driven AutoCAD Drafter to join our team in producing clear, high-accuracy technical drawings and layout plans. In this role, you will work closely with our engineering and project teams to transform initial concepts, sketches, and specifications into production-ready CAD models and detail packages.


Key Responsibilities

  • Drafting & Detailing: Create, update, and finalize 2D/3D technical drawings, schematics, and assembly layouts using AutoCAD.
  • Design Collaboration: Coordinate directly with engineers, project managers, and shop floor staff to verify dimensions, materials, and design specs.
  • Revision Control: Incorporate engineering markups, redlines, and field changes quickly while maintaining accurate drawing revision records.
  • Standards & Documentation: Adhere to internal CAD standards, layer conventions, and drafting guidelines; prepare bill of materials (BOMs) for production.


Key Qualifications & Requirements

  • Experience: Minimum of 2 years of practical drafting/design experience in a manufacturing, structural, or industrial drafting environment.
  • Software Mastery: Proficiency in AutoCAD (2D drafting required, 3D experience preferred).
  • Technical Aptitude: Strong ability to read and interpret blue prints, redlines, geometric tolerances, and technical specifications.
  • Work Style: Sharp attention to detail, strong spatial reasoning, and the ability to manage multiple drawing deadlines with minimal supervision.
  • Education: Associate degree in Drafting/CAD Technology, vocational certification, or equivalent practical shop-floor drafting experience.
